Added support for default hash functions in all PKCS algorithm schemes.
authorPekka Riikonen <priikone@silcnet.org>
Wed, 5 Mar 2008 18:58:27 +0000 (20:58 +0200)
committerPekka Riikonen <priikone@silcnet.org>
Wed, 5 Mar 2008 18:58:27 +0000 (20:58 +0200)
commitbd548b5771a325d3dc051887d3fd0225550d4418
tree964c0b5d2f0c58afb84e4d733c4744b6435cca6f
parent957577debbf00959048d7a5adebdff8d5019f1d5
Added support for default hash functions in all PKCS algorithm schemes.

Each PKCS algorithm scheme now allocates default hash function.  The
hash function is used in signature computation and verification if
user does not give it as argument to silc_pkcs_sign or silc_pkcs_verify.
lib/silccrypt/dsa.c
lib/silccrypt/dsa.h
lib/silccrypt/rsa.c
lib/silccrypt/rsa.h
lib/silccrypt/silcpkcs1.c
lib/silccrypt/silcpkcs1.h
lib/silccrypt/silcpkcs_i.h
lib/silccrypt/silcrng.h